Teacup candles

By Debbiedoo's Team Published: Mar 5, 2012 · Modified: Dec 18, 2016

I have a very lovely collection of vintage tea cups that have been passed down to me from family, both an Aunt and my FIL.  
There is no shortage of china in my house.
 I saw these lovely tea cup candles on a wedding site, and they say they were from
Anthropolgie. 
 

                                           Teacup Candle Favors :  wedding candles diy favors Teacup teacup.jpg    {Anthropologie}

Very pricely I may add.  about $23.00 a tea cup.  Ummmm….I don’t think so.
How about Free for me!
 
I brought out a few of my favorite, and I decided I would make my own pretty vignette on our bedroom dresser.
 

These music note roses I bought for $5.00 on a recent trip to the antique mall.  

They are so pretty!

I just added a tea light to the tea cups!

They look so pretty on our dresser.
 
I know, I know, too easy right!
Well for one I won’t ruin the teacup and for two, I can actually enjoy them and they look pretty lit up.
 
 
 
 
Like I mentioned I have a beautiful collection.  I am sure my FIL is happy that I love these and use them, perhaps not in a traditional way, but none the less I get to enjoy them.
